Description

This 24-year-old woman came to our practice interested in removing her left forehead under-the-skin bump. She has had this for ~4 years, and the bump has grown slowly.  She reported several steroid injections with her Dermatologist in an attempt to shrink this down, without much change.  Our patient was bothered by the appearance of this painless bump, and wanted it removed for cosmetic reasons and with as little visible scarring as possible.

Our facial plastic surgeon Dr. Inessa Fishman diagnosed the patient with a likely forehead lipoma after doing a thorough physical exam and ultrasound imaging.  Dr. Fishman removed the growth through a small incision in the patient’s scalp hair so as to eliminate the chance of visible scarring on his face.  The patient had her surgery in the comfort of our clinic, while awake and relaxed with by-mouth relaxing medications and laughing gas. She is shown just 1 week after surgery, immediately after getting her stitches removed; with a great outcome and essentially invisible scarring that is already well-hidden by her scalp hair.

About Lipomas & Osteomas Procedures

Lipomas, osteomas, and various other “bumps” on the scalp, face, and neck are common concerns among patients who come to our practice.  A lipoma is a benign (non-cancerous) fatty growth which may appear on various parts of the body, face and scalp; while an osteoma is a growth of bone which can form on the forehead or skull.  Our facial plastic surgeon Dr. Inessa Fishman commonly treats lipomas and osteomas as well as a variety of other bumps and cysts on the face and neck.Learn More About Lipoma TreatmentLearn More About Osteoma Treatment
